Program Notes

Prokofiev’s Second Violin Concerto transports the audience from somber notes to soaring themes and a frenetic finale. Daniel Lozakovich joins Principal Guest Conductor Nathalie Stutzmann and the Orchestra for this dynamic concerto. Tchaikovsky’s final symphony, completed just nine days before his death, stands as a soaring work and is filled with raw emotions ranging from sunny exuberance to solemn introspection. With his lush orchestrations and graceful melodies, Tchaikovsky captures this spectrum of sentiments with captivating technique and brilliance.
